Transaction 823518da8926f9866301945c0d4be30286079fbc724e62ea358b886d23370eb9
1 Input
1 Output
-
823518da8926f9866301945c0d4be30286079fbc724e62ea358b886d23370eb9:0
- value
- 61781600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4839e6566edd1f96a4ed533410cf17fd2fc13b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PHsYqXT2TEWGqsaKSPxQarbGksBksyqYS